Firstly, let's delve into what Play Store mining apps actually offer. These applications claim to harness the processing power of your smartphone to mine various cryptocurrencies. The allure is understandable—simply install an app and start earning digital currency while you go about your daily activities. Sounds almost too good to be true, right? Well, there's a catch.
The reality is that smartphone-based mining is far less efficient compared to dedicated mining hardware. Smartphones are not designed with the high computational power required for effective mining. Additionally, running these apps can significantly drain your battery and potentially damage your device due to overheating. Therefore, the returns, if any, are often negligible and hardly justify the risks involved.
Moreover, the legitimacy of these apps is a major concern. Many have been flagged for fraudulent activities, including data theft and unauthorized access to personal information. Users must exercise extreme caution when downloading such apps, ensuring they come from reputable developers and have positive user reviews.
